## Authentication

The Driftgate migration runner needs a service key to talk to Ledgermast, the internal schema-coordination service. Without it, expand/contract phases cannot acquire locks and migrations will stall — this is the most common on-call page for this system. Keys are scoped per environment; never reuse prod keys in staging. If the runner logs `auth: rejected`, rotate via the vault CLI and restart. Tokens expire after 90 days. For the current production environment, authenticate with the key below:

service key, fawip-bajef: kto11_Qt5wZK9vdNC

**Key Ceremony Checklist — Step 12: Formula Sandbox Keys (Thornquill)**

New team members: read before signing.

☐ Generate the attestation key for the Thornquill formula sandbox. This key signs the isolation policy that confines user-supplied formulas — no file access, no network, bounded CPU. Without a valid signature, the evaluator refuses all formulas.

☐ Two officers present. Verify badges. No phones in the room.

☐ Record serials in the ledger.

☐ Seal the backup shard. The shard's recovery passphrase goes on the line below.

unlock words, hahip-baduf: holwyn-istath-julvan

Subject: Q3 Regional Sales Review — Eastvale District

Team,

Q3 figures for the Eastvale district are in. Revenue rose 4% over Q2, driven mainly by the Corvalis appliance line, while margins in Northbrook remained flat. Full breakdowns will follow in the finance pack on Thursday. Before then, please review the note below.

board note of fahog-bawep: The renewal with Holixax Holdings closes at $20 million a year, 20 percent below the last contract. Project Druwyn slips by two quarters because of the supplier delay.

MEMO — Blueprint Delivery, Permit Filing

To the Thornway Annex receiving site: the stamped blueprints for the Millgrove extension permit leave our office Monday in a sealed tube, two copies only. Accept no partial sets. The planning office deadline is Thursday, so same-day confirmation is required. The courier will complete hand-over as instructed below.

handover note for yagef-bagep: the drudor pelius courier leaves the kasdor zorvan norir ledger at gate 8016 under passcode 755406